WebNov 29, 2024 · Taking Plan B can cause bleeding because levonorgestrel changes the stability of the uterine lining that you shed during your period, which can lead to unexpected bleeding, Gersh says. WebMar 8, 2015 · It is very normal to bleed after taking Plan B, & for that bleeding to be heavy. It is also very normal to find your next period is up to a week late, & that it is lighter or heavier than normal. Plan B can make you feel very hormonal for a couple of weeks.
